Description
Summary
I have experienced a major performance degradation with streamable HTTP clients on certain servers starting in version 1.12.0 which is still present in the current version (1.13.0). I see this issue with the Notion remote MCP server on streamable HTTP transport (https://mcp.notion.com/mcp). While other servers work fine, there is a ~10 second delay with any operation on an established client session to this server after v1.11.0. The performance is fine at v1.11.0, and is fine with the current version of inspector.

Comments
As written in my testing repo, I have profiled the OAuthClientProvider and don't believe there is an issue with that. This issue is present when establishing client sessions and calling established client sessions. I believe there must be an underlying issue with the streamable HTTP transport that is only manifest with some servers, but that is beyond my expertise.
Example Code
Python & MCP Python SDK
Python 3.12.11 used for all testing.
Issue present in version 1.12.1 to 1.13.0.
Issue NOT present in version 1.11.0.
No results for version 1.12.0 due to unrelated (as far as I can tell) bug.
